Overview
Will (trading as Will Forex Limited) is a forex brokerage founded on 11 April 2021 and based in China, according to regulatory records. The firm operates the website will-fx.net, though this domain is currently inaccessible, preventing independent verification of its offerings.
The company describes itself as a forex broker registered in Hong Kong, but no concrete evidence of such registration exists in public registries. As a result, the broker's true operational status remains unclear, and traders should exercise extreme caution.
Regulation and Safety
Will holds no known regulatory authorisation from any financial authority. This absence of oversight means that clients have no recourse through a regulatory ombudsman or compensation scheme in the event of a dispute or loss of funds.
The lack of regulation is a significant red flag. Without mandatory capital requirements, client fund segregation, or periodic audits, the broker poses a heightened risk of mismanagement or fraudulent activity.
Company Details
Records indicate that Will was incorporated on 11 April 2021, though the exact jurisdiction is ambiguous: the company describes itself as Hong Kong-registered, while other data points to China as the country of registration. This discrepancy further complicates due diligence.
As the official website is offline, no information about company management, physical office address, or corporate structure is available. This opacity is concerning for potential clients seeking transparency.

Conclusion for Traders
Will presents a high-risk profile due to its complete lack of regulation, inaccessible website, and vague corporate registration. Without verifiable trading conditions or client protections, this broker is unsuitable for most retail traders.
Traders are strongly advised to avoid any dealings with Will until the broker can provide clear, independently verifiable information and obtains proper regulation.
